Merge version_6 into main #9

Merged
bender merged 1 commits from version_6 into main 2026-04-23 11:12:39 +00:00

View File

@@ -2,19 +2,19 @@
import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ider";
import ReactLenis from "lenis/react";
import { ArrowRight } from "lucide-react";
import HeroSplit from '@/components/sections/hero/HeroSplit';
import TestimonialAboutCard from '@/components/sections/about/TestimonialAboutCard';
import { ArrowRight, CheckCircle, HelpCircle } from "lucide-react";
import ContactSplitForm from '@/components/sections/contact/ContactSplitForm';
import FaqBase from '@/components/sections/faq/FaqBase';
import FeatureCardNine from '@/components/sections/feature/FeatureCardNine';
import FeatureCardTwentyFive from '@/components/sections/feature/FeatureCardTwentyFive';
import ProductCardTwo from '@/components/sections/product/ProductCardTwo';
import MetricCardOne from '@/components/sections/metrics/MetricCardOne';
import FaqBase from '@/components/sections/faq/FaqBase';
import ContactSplitForm from '@/components/sections/contact/ContactSplitForm';
import FooterBaseReveal from '@/components/sections/footer/FooterBaseReveal';
import FooterCard from '@/components/sections/footer/FooterCard';
import LegalSection from '@/components/legal/LegalSection';
import HeroSplit from '@/components/sections/hero/HeroSplit';
import MetricCardOne from '@/components/sections/metrics/MetricCardOne';
import NavbarStyleFullscreen from '@/components/navbar/NavbarStyleFullscreen/NavbarStyleFullscreen';
import ProductCardTwo from '@/components/sections/product/ProductCardTwo';
import TestimonialAboutCard from '@/components/sections/about/TestimonialAboutCard';
import LegalSection from '@/components/legal/LegalSection';
export default function LandingPage() {
return (
@@ -36,7 +36,7 @@ export default function LandingPage() {
navItems={[
{ name: "Shop", id: "products" },
{ name: "About", id: "about" },
{ name: "Reviews", id: "testimonials" },
{ name: "FAQ", id: "faq" },
{ name: "Contact", id: "contact" },
]}
brandName="KOOLKY"
@@ -45,124 +45,115 @@ export default function LandingPage() {
<div id="hero" data-section="hero">
<HeroSplit
background={{ variant: "rotated-rays-static" }}
title="Wear Your Mindset"
description="Style that speaks your mindset. Confidence you can wear."
buttons={[{ text: "Shop The Mindset", href: "#products" }]}
imageSrc="http://img.b2bpic.net/free-photo/full-shot-punk-woman-posing_23-2149267430.jpg"
mediaAnimation="none"
background={{ variant: "rotated-rays-static" }}
/>
</div>
<div id="about" data-section="about">
<TestimonialAboutCard
tag="Our Story"
title="Designed for the driven"
description="KOOLKY is more than apparel; it's a movement for those who demand excellence."
subdescription="Built for those who lead."
icon={ArrowRight}
title="Confidence You Can Wear"
description="At KOOLKY, we don't just design clothes; we create armor for your mindset."
subdescription="Inspired by the hunger and drive of today's youth, our streetwear is built to push you forward."
icon={CheckCircle}
imageSrc="http://img.b2bpic.net/free-photo/medium-shot-young-woman-posing-black-white_23-2149392896.jpg"
useInvertedBackground={false}
/>
</div>
<div id="features-nine" data-section="features-nine">
<FeatureCardNine
showStepNumbers={true}
title="Process"
description="How we craft excellence."
animationType="slide-up"
textboxLayout="default"
useInvertedBackground={false}
features={[
{ title: "Design", description: "Crafting the vision", phoneOne: { imageSrc: "http://img.b2bpic.net/free-photo/digital-art-style-fashion-design-sketch-paper_23-2151486993.jpg" }, phoneTwo: { imageSrc: "http://img.b2bpic.net/free-photo/digital-art-style-fashion-design-sketch-paper_23-2151486993.jpg" } }
]}
/>
<div id="feature1" data-section="feature1">
<FeatureCardNine
title="How It Works"
description="Experience the KOOLKY difference step by step."
showStepNumbers={true}
animationType="slide-up"
textboxLayout="default"
features={[
{ title: "Design", description: "Hand-drawn concepts.", phoneOne: { imageSrc: "http://img.b2bpic.net/free-photo/digital-art-style-fashion-design-sketch-paper_23-2151486993.jpg" }, phoneTwo: { imageSrc: "http://img.b2bpic.net/free-photo/digital-art-style-fashion-design-sketch-paper_23-2151486993.jpg" } },
{ title: "Production", description: "Eco-friendly crafting.", phoneOne: { imageSrc: "http://img.b2bpic.net/free-photo/clothes-clothing-store_23-2148164875.jpg" }, phoneTwo: { imageSrc: "http://img.b2bpic.net/free-photo/clothes-clothing-store_23-2148164875.jpg" } }
]}
/>
</div>
<div id="features-twenty-five" data-section="features-twenty-five">
<FeatureCardTwentyFive
title="Key Features"
description="Why choose KOOLKY"
animationType="slide-up"
textboxLayout="default"
useInvertedBackground={true}
features={[
{ title: "Premium Quality", description: "Top-tier materials", icon: ArrowRight, mediaItems: [{ imageSrc: "http://img.b2bpic.net/free-photo/fashionable-clothing-collection-modern-boutique-store-generated-by-ai_188544-33893.jpg" }, { imageSrc: "http://img.b2bpic.net/free-photo/fashionable-clothing-collection-modern-boutique-store-generated-by-ai_188544-33893.jpg" }] }
]}
/>
<div id="feature2" data-section="feature2">
<FeatureCardTwentyFive
title="Innovation at Core"
description="We use technology to enhance your style."
animationType="blur-reveal"
textboxLayout="default"
useInvertedBackground={true}
features={[
{ title: "Smart Fabric", description: "Adaptive tech.", icon: CheckCircle, mediaItems: [{ imageSrc: "http://img.b2bpic.net/free-photo/young-man-listening-music-headphones-close-up_23-2148381737.jpg" }, { imageSrc: "http://img.b2bpic.net/free-photo/young-man-listening-music-headphones-close-up_23-2148381737.jpg" }] },
{ title: "Design Lab", description: "AI-powered trends.", icon: CheckCircle, mediaItems: [{ imageSrc: "http://img.b2bpic.net/free-photo/fashion-photo-young-magnificent-woman-grey-shirt_158595-901.jpg" }, { imageSrc: "http://img.b2bpic.net/free-photo/fashion-photo-young-magnificent-woman-grey-shirt_158595-901.jpg" }] }
]}
/>
</div>
<div id="products" data-section="products">
<ProductCardTwo
gridVariant="four-items-2x2-equal-grid"
title="Featured Arrivals"
description="Our latest collection."
animationType="slide-up"
title="Shop Latest"
description="Premium gear awaits."
textboxLayout="default"
useInvertedBackground={false}
gridVariant="four-items-2x2-equal-grid"
products={[
{ id: "p1", brand: "KOOLKY", name: "Essential Tee", price: "$35", rating: 5, reviewCount: "100", imageSrc: "http://img.b2bpic.net/free-photo/portrait-attractive-man-close-ears-from-noisy-neighbours-looking-up-shouting-annoyed-hearing-loud-music-isolated-background_1150-63498.jpg" }
{ id: "p1", brand: "KOOLKY", name: "Street Tee", price: "$35", rating: 5, reviewCount: "100+", imageSrc: "http://img.b2bpic.net/free-photo/portrait-attractive-man-close-ears-from-noisy-neighbours-looking-up-shouting-annoyed-hearing-loud-music-isolated-background_1150-63498.jpg" }
]}
/>
</div>
<div id="metrics" data-section="metrics">
<MetricCardOne
gridVariant="uniform-all-items-equal"
animationType="slide-up"
title="Our Impact"
description="Growth and Trust"
textboxLayout="default"
useInvertedBackground={false}
metrics={[
{ id: "m1", value: "15K+", title: "Customers", description: "Satisfied", icon: ArrowRight }
]}
/>
<MetricCardOne
title="Impact Metrics"
description="Driven by community numbers."
animationType="slide-up"
gridVariant="uniform-all-items-equal"
metrics={[
{ id: "m1", value: "15K+", title: "Customers", description: "Happy shoppers", icon: CheckCircle }
]}
/>
</div>
<div id="contact" data-section="contact">
<ContactSplitForm
title="Contact Support"
description="Questions? We are here."
inputs={[
{ name: "name", type: "text", placeholder: "Name" },
{ name: "email", type: "email", placeholder: "Email" },
]}
title="Contact Us"
description="We are here for you."
inputs={[{ name: "name", type: "text", placeholder: "Name" }, { name: "email", type: "email", placeholder: "Email" }]}
imageSrc="http://img.b2bpic.net/free-photo/woman-choosing-clothes-shop_23-2147669917.jpg"
useInvertedBackground={false}
/>
</div>
<div id="footer-reveal" data-section="footer-reveal">
<FooterBaseReveal
logoText="KOOLKY"
columns={[{ title: "Links", items: [{ label: "Home", href: "/" }] }]}
/>
<FooterBaseReveal
logoText="KOOLKY"
columns={[{ title: "Company", items: [{ label: "Home", href: "/" }] }]}
/>
</div>
<div id="faq" data-section="faq">
<FaqBase
title="Common Questions"
description="Everything you need to know."
textboxLayout="default"
useInvertedBackground={false}
title="FAQ"
faqs={[{ id: "1", title: "Returns?", content: "Easy returns." }]}
faqsAnimation="slide-up"
faqs={[{ id: "q1", title: "Shipping?", content: "3-5 days." }]}
/>
</div>
<div id="footer-card" data-section="footer-card">
<FooterCard logoText="KOOLKY" />
<FooterCard
logoText="KOOLKY"
/>
</div>
<div id="legal" data-section="legal">
<LegalSection
layout="section"
title="Legal Notices"
sections={[{ heading: "Privacy", content: { type: "paragraph", text: "We protect your data." } }]}
/>
<LegalSection
layout="section"
title="Terms"
sections={[{ heading: "Policy", content: { type: "paragraph", text: "All sales final." } }]}
/>
</div>
</ReactLenis>
</ThemeProvider>
);